fickit: Add scores-sync-zqds to frontend

This commit is contained in:
nemunaire 2021-09-09 11:23:20 +02:00
parent 5eeb1a6297
commit b9a220c359
1 changed files with 19 additions and 0 deletions

View File

@ -190,6 +190,17 @@ services:
- /var/lib/fic/startingblock
- /var/lib/fic/submissions
- /var/lib/fic/teams
- name: fic-remote-scores-sync-zqds
image: nemunaire/fic-remote-scores-sync-zqds:latest
env:
- ZQDS_EVENTID=6109ae5acbb7b36b789c9330
- ZQDS_ROUNDID=612d3a5179fe4f747ea89274
- ZQDS_CLIENTID=
- ZQDS_CLIENTSECRET=
binds:
- /etc/hosts:/etc/hosts:ro
- /var/lib/fic/teams:/srv/TEAMS:ro
net: /run/netns/nginx
- name: sshd
image: nemunaire/rsync:5d1f678641de2197041f4bc4c745e7748bedab02
capabilities:
@ -336,6 +347,11 @@ files:
source: configs/nsenter_process.sh
mode: "0755"
- path: etc/resolv.conf
contents: |
nameserver 9.9.9.9
mode: "0444"
- path: etc/dhcpcd.conf
contents: |
allowinterfaces internet
@ -428,6 +444,9 @@ files:
[0:0] -A OUTPUT -p icmp --icmp-type 0 -j ACCEPT
[0:0] -A OUTPUT -p icmp --icmp-type 8 -j ACCEPT
[0:0] -A OUTPUT -o bond-frontal -p udp -m udp --sport domain -j ACCEPT
[0:0] -A OUTPUT -o bond-frontal -d 9.9.9.9 -p udp -m udp --dport domain -j ACCEPT
[0:0] -A OUTPUT -o bond-frontal -d 9.9.9.9 -p tcp -m tcp --dport domain -j ACCEPT
[0:0] -A OUTPUT -o bond-frontal -d 94.23.5.143 -p tcp -m tcp --dport https -j ACCEPT
[0:0] -A OUTPUT -m conntrack --ctstate RELATED,ESTABLISHED -j ACCEPT
[0:0] -A OUTPUT -o vethin-nginx -d 172.17.1.3 -p tcp -m conntrack --ctstate NEW -m tcp --dport 8080 -j ACCEPT
[0:0] -A OUTPUT -o vethin-nginx -d 172.17.1.4 -p tcp -m conntrack --ctstate NEW -m tcp --dport 5556 -j ACCEPT